Waba Grill – Salmon Bowl is a Waba Grill type of food with 1 Bowl serving size that provides 620 calories. Waba Grill – Salmon Bowl has 54% carbohydrate, and 24% fat, 23% protein in 100 gram of Waba Grill – Salmon Bowl. Waba Grill – Salmon Bowl nutrient values are 81 g carbohydrate, 34 g protein, and 16 g fat. Waba Grill – Salmon Bowl has the vitamins A, and C within it. Waba Grill – Salmon Bowl has 0 % vitamin A and 0 % vitamin C. Waba Grill – Salmon Bowl has 75 mg sodium, 0 mg potassium, 75 mg cholesterol, and 0 g trans fat. Waba Grill – Salmon Bowl has 1 g dietary fiber, and 1 g sugar. 1 serving of Waba Grill – Salmon Bowl provides 0 % iron, 0 g polyunsaturated and 0 g unsaturated fat along with 3 g saturated fat.
